Avast! Also has a free personal version. Most companies make a free
version for personal use these days, but finding a free one that is
legal for corporate use is a real impossibility (Other then Clam, which
is, sadly, not good enough)

On Sat, 12 May 2007 15:50, keith smith wrote
> I seem to recall there was a real good free anti-virus software
> for WinXP but cannot recall what it might have been.


ClamWin Free Antivirus replaces McAfee ViruScanetc,
Norton Antivirus or Kaspersky Anti-Virus. http://www.clamwin.com/
a free antivirus for M$ Windows 98/Me/2000/XP and 2003 features:
- High detection rates for viruses and spyware, scanning scheduler,
- Automatic downloads of regularly updated Virus Database.
- Standalone virus scanner and menu integration to M$ Windows Explorer
- Addin to M$ Outlook to remove virus-infected attachments
automatically.
